REVOLUTION by Eric Metaxas (Audiobook)(Nonfiction)
Author: Eric Metaxas; Narrator: Eric Metaxas
Full Title: Revolution: The Birth of the Greatest Nation in the History of the World
Release Year: 2026
Length: 26h 52m
Genres: History, Nonfiction, Politics, Religion & Spirituality
Eric Metaxas's "Revolution" offers a definitive and sweeping account of the American Revolution, aiming to bring the epic story of America's birth to life for a new generation. The book delves into the incredible stories and events that led to the founding of the United States, a nation unique in human history. Metaxas explores the sacrifices, character, and faith that underpinned the struggle for liberty, highlighting key figures such as George Washington, John Adams, and Nathan Hale. The narrative covers the period from the events leading up to Lexington and Concord, through the various twists and turns of the war, including pivotal battles like Bunker Hill and Saratoga, and the winter at Valley Forge, culminating in the victory at Yorktown. Metaxas seeks to remind readers of the true story of the Revolution and its enduring significance for the nation's identity. With a blend of erudition and wit, the author presents a compelling and entertaining historical narrative.
